The Blue Note in Greenwich Village is one of the most famous jazz clubs in the world, hosting legendary performers nightly in an intimate setting that defines the NYC jazz experience.
Brooklyn Brewery helped launch the American craft beer movement. Visit their Williamsburg taproom for tours, tastings, and a rotating selection of innovative brews.
PDT (Please Don't Tell) is a legendary speakeasy-style cocktail bar hidden behind a phone booth inside Crif Dogs on St. Marks Place. Reservations-only craft cocktails in a cozy underground space.
Lee's Tavern in Dongan Hills has been serving its famous thin-crust bar pizza and cold beers since 1940. A Staten Island institution where locals have gathered for generations.
Bohemian Hall & Beer Garden is a massive, tree-lined outdoor beer garden in Astoria that's been serving since 1910. Perfect for warm-weather drinking with friends — a true NYC gem.
Blind Barber in the East Village combines a full-service barbershop with a hidden cocktail lounge in the back. Classic cuts and craft cocktails — the ultimate NYC two-for-one.
Flagship Brewing Company is Staten Island's first brewery since Prohibition, crafting small-batch beers in their Tompkinsville taproom. A proud local spot that's putting SI on the craft beer map.
Sakagura is a subterranean sake bar tucked beneath a Midtown office building, offering over 200 sakes and refined Japanese izakaya cuisine. One of NYC's best-kept secrets for Japanese culture lovers.

Killmeyer's Old Bavaria Inn is one of Staten Island's most historic establishments, serving authentic German fare and steins of imported beer in a charming beer garden setting since 1859.
Mott Haven Bar & Grill is a friendly neighborhood spot in the rapidly evolving Mott Haven area, serving hearty American comfort food, cold beers, and weekend brunch with live music.
Bemelmans Bar at The Carlyle is one of Manhattan's most elegant cocktail destinations, with original murals by Ludwig Bemelmans, live jazz piano, and classic cocktails in an opulent Art Deco setting.
